Does anyone know where I can find a list for NPC sororities of what constitutes rush infractions. Our VP of recruitment sent around a list basically outlining some things and saying that this summer(if we were in the area) we should not really talk up our sorority to anyone because they might be potential rushees, and it could be considered a rush infraction. But I love my sorority and if it came up in conversation, its something that I normally talk about. I understand it would a rush infraction as far as promising a bid, or bad-mouthing another organization. But if I were to say how being Greek has made me a better person, or how much I have learned from my sisters, I don't really understand how this is an infraction. What do you all think?

Some schools are more strict than others with rush violations, so I would err on the side of caution. If it does come up in conversation, just talk up the Greek system in general. If whoever you're talking to asks more detailed questions, just tell them straight out that you aren't permitted to talk about it because of rush rules. Yes it is kind of stupid, but it's not worth getting an infraction. You never know when someone is going to be a "spy" and run to another sorority with reports!!

At my school we can talk about our sorority all we want until the week of rush (our Rho Chi's don't dissaffiliate until the day before rush!). So we can talk us up all we want UNTIL then. But you need to check your panhellenic's rules regarding this. They set the rules. At our school rush infractions can be anywhere from a $500 fine up to a $1,000 so make sure you are clear!

Hey ilovemy glo, how do rho chi's work on your campus if they deaffiliate the day before rush? on my campus, rho chi's have to deaffiliate in August before school starts so that they are "impartial" and potential new members don't know what chapters that rho chi's are from. if potentials know what the rho chi's are, what stops the girls from following their rho chi's choice and not their own?
at my university, we have greek forums and picnics and stuff where you can set up a booth and talk to prospectives before rush. there's nothing wrong with talking up your organization as long as you don't say "rush beta beta beta"...it has to be about going greek in general. you can't offer a verbal bid or say things like "i'll see you later/tomorrow/soon" because girls could it the wrong way. you can also get rush infractions if the girls take anything away from your booth or rush party. those are just a few but you can contact your panhellenic rep. if you are unsure whether something is an infraction or not.
